Colour Schemes Included
-
Sikorsky S-38B - 214-10 — 'NC-113M', New York, Rio, and Buenos Aires Line, Inc. of New York, 1929
-
Sikorsky S-38B - 314-1 — 'NC-943M', Pan American Airways, based in Puerto Rico in 1931 & Trinidad in 1932
-
Sikorsky S-38BS - 414-20 — 'NC-29V' (OSA's ARK): Martin & Osa Johnson's African Flights, 1933
-
Sikorsky S-38 - 314-12 — 'NC-6V' (CARNAUBA): S.C. Johnson & Son, Inc., Carnauba aerial expedition in Brazil, 1935
-
Sikorsky PS-2 - A-8285 — U.S. Navy, November 1933
